What Is Astaxanthin and Where Does It Come From?
Astaxanthin is a xanthophyll carotenoid, a reddish pigment in the same chemical family as beta-carotene and lutein but with a structure that gives it notably stronger antioxidant capacity in lab studies. It occurs naturally in the microalga Haematococcus pluvialis, which produces it as a defense against UV stress and drought. That pigment moves up the food chain into salmon, shrimp, krill, and other seafood, which is why wild salmon has that distinct pink color.
Supplement companies grow Haematococcus pluvialis in controlled ponds or bioreactors, then extract the pigment for capsules. A few points worth knowing before you shop:
- Natural algal-source astaxanthin is the form used in nearly every human clinical trial.
- Synthetic astaxanthin, often made for aquaculture feed, has a different molecular structure and has not been tested in the same human studies.
- Common consumer forms include softgels with oil-based delivery, standalone liquid extracts, and topical serums meant to complement oral use.
How Does Astaxanthin Work as an Antioxidant?
Astaxanthin’s molecular shape lets it sit across a cell membrane and neutralize reactive oxygen species on both the inside and outside of the cell, a trick most antioxidants can’t manage. That includes singlet oxygen quenching, a specific form of oxidative damage linked to UV exposure and skin aging.
The more interesting mechanism isn’t direct scavenging, though. Astaxanthin also activates Nrf2, a signaling pathway that tells your cells to ramp up their own antioxidant enzymes, including superoxide dismutase. At the same time, it dampens NF-κB, a pathway that switches on inflammatory genes. That dual action, boosting your body’s defenses while quieting inflammatory signaling, is why researchers see effects in tissues as different as skin, retina, and blood vessels.
- Quenches singlet oxygen and protects lipid membranes directly
- Switches on Nrf2, increasing endogenous antioxidant enzyme production
- Suppresses NF-κB, reducing inflammatory cytokine output
- Suppresses UVB-induced cytokines and MMP-1 in skin cells specifically

What Does the Research Say About Astaxanthin Benefits for Skin, Eyes, Heart, and Brain?
Skin is where the evidence is strongest and most consistent. A meta-analysis of nine randomized controlled trials found oral astaxanthin significantly improved skin moisture and elasticity, with visible improvement in crow’s feet wrinkles after eight weeks at 6 mg daily in some trials. A separate 16-week randomized, double-blind trial with 65 women tested both 6 mg and 12 mg doses against placebo and found astaxanthin prevented the seasonal skin deterioration the placebo group experienced, with the higher dose group maintaining lower inflammatory IL-1α levels in the skin’s outer layer.

Eye comfort has a smaller but coherent evidence base. Trials in adults 40 and older report modest gains in accommodative function, the eye’s ability to refocus, and reduced visual fatigue at 4 to 12 mg daily over 8 to 12 weeks.
Cardiometabolic markers show the most rigorously pooled data. A GRADE-assessed systematic review of 16 trials covering 694 participants found astaxanthin supplementation associated with meaningful reductions in oxidative stress markers and modest improvements in LDL-C and triglycerides. The effect sizes were small on their own, a few milligrams per deciliter, but the pattern held across trials, and larger reductions showed up in the subgroup taking 12 mg or more daily for 12 weeks or longer.

Brain and cognition research is the thinnest of the group. Small randomized trials report modest improvements in memory and psychomotor performance at similar 6 to 12 mg doses over 8 to 12 weeks, but sample sizes are limited enough that these findings should be read as promising rather than settled.
Exercise recovery research is still preliminary. A handful of trials suggest astaxanthin reduces exercise-induced oxidative stress and post-workout inflammation, but protocols vary enough between studies that it’s hard to draw a single dosing conclusion yet.
How Much Astaxanthin Should You Take, and When Will You See Results?
Clinical trials mostly cluster in the 4 to 12 mg per day range, with 6 mg being the most common starting dose for skin outcomes and doses of 12 mg or higher associated with larger lipid and inflammatory effects. A few trials studying oxidative stress markers alone used doses as low as 2 mg.
Timeline matters more than most people expect going in. Skin hydration and elasticity changes typically show up around 6 to 8 weeks of consistent daily use, while some protective effects against inflammatory skin markers weren’t measurable until 12 to 16 weeks in.
- Take astaxanthin with a meal containing fat, since it’s fat-soluble and absorption improves substantially with dietary lipids like olive oil or avocado
- Expect 8 weeks minimum before judging whether it’s working
- Consistency beats dose size. Daily use for 3 to 4 months tends to outperform sporadic higher-dose use
Is Astaxanthin Safe? Side Effects and Drug Interactions to Know
Astaxanthin is generally well tolerated across the clinical trials reviewed here, with side effects reported infrequently. When they occur, they tend to be mild gastrointestinal upset or a reddish discoloration of stool at higher doses, which is harmless but can be alarming if you’re not expecting it.
The more important consideration is interaction risk. Astaxanthin has theoretical effects on blood pressure and blood clotting, which means people on anticoagulants, blood pressure medications, or diabetes drugs should talk to their doctor before starting a regimen. This isn’t a documented pattern of dangerous interactions so much as a reasonable precaution given the mechanism.
- Stop use and seek medical care for signs of an allergic reaction, unusual bruising, or unexpected bleeding
- Flag any new medication start to your doctor if you’re already taking astaxanthin regularly
- People managing blood sugar or blood pressure with medication should get clearance before adding it

Where Does Astaxanthin Come From, and How Do You Choose a Good Supplement?
Wild salmon, shrimp, and krill all contain astaxanthin naturally, but the amounts in a typical serving of salmon are far below what clinical trials use. Getting to 6 to 12 mg through diet alone isn’t realistic for most people, which is why supplementation is the practical route for anyone chasing the doses studies actually tested.
Nearly all supplement-grade astaxanthin comes from Haematococcus pluvialis grown specifically for extraction. Check the label for algal sourcing rather than a generic “astaxanthin” listing, since synthetic versions exist and haven’t been through the same human trials.
- Confirm the dose per capsule matches the 4 to 12 mg range used in research
- Favor oil-based softgel delivery, which supports the fat-soluble absorption astaxanthin needs
- Look for third-party testing (USP, NSF, or an equivalent independent verification)
- Check for a clear, single-ingredient label rather than a proprietary blend that hides the actual dose
- Consider combining oral supplementation with a topical formula, since small studies suggest the pairing produces more visible skin results than either alone

What Do Recent Meta-Analyses Say About Astaxanthin’s Overall Evidence Base?
Pooled trial data consistently shows two things: improvements in skin moisture and elasticity, and reductions in oxidative stress and select lipid markers. The GRADE-assessed cardiometabolic review found triglyceride reductions of roughly 2.9 mg/dL and LDL-C reductions around 1.09 mg/dL across 16 pooled trials, modest numbers individually, but consistent enough across studies to be statistically meaningful.
The landmark 16-week Japanese skin trial remains the most frequently cited piece of evidence for the anti-aging framing that dominates astaxanthin marketing, largely because it directly measured seasonal skin deterioration rather than a subjective wellness score. A broader review of astaxanthin’s role in aging and oxidative stress echoes the same caveat found throughout this literature: heterogeneity between trials and small sample sizes mean the field still needs larger, standardized studies before these effect sizes can be called settled science.

Frequently Asked Questions About Astaxanthin Benefits
What is astaxanthin good for? It’s primarily studied for skin hydration and elasticity, antioxidant status, cardiometabolic markers like LDL and triglycerides, eye comfort, and modest cognitive support, with skin showing the most consistent trial results.
How long does it take to see astaxanthin benefits for skin? Most trials report visible improvements in skin moisture and elasticity after 6 to 8 weeks of daily use, with some protective effects against inflammatory changes appearing closer to 12 to 16 weeks.
What is the recommended astaxanthin dosage? Clinical trials most commonly use 4 to 12 mg per day, with 6 mg being typical for skin studies and 12 mg or higher associated with larger cardiometabolic effects.
Can astaxanthin interact with medications? It has theoretical effects on blood pressure and clotting, so anyone taking blood thinners, blood pressure medication, or diabetes drugs should consult their doctor before starting it.
Is natural astaxanthin better than synthetic astaxanthin? Nearly all human clinical trials use natural, algal-source astaxanthin from Haematococcus pluvialis. Synthetic versions haven’t been tested in the same studies, so sticking with algal-source products keeps you aligned with the actual evidence.
